#594563 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#594563 is composed of 34.9% red, 27.1% green and 38.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 10.1% cyan, 30.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 61.2% black. It has a hue angle of 280 degrees, a saturation of 17.9% and a lightness of 32.9%. #594563 color hex could be obtained by blending #b28ac6 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

Shades and Tints of #594563
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060507 is the darkest color, while #fbfafb is the lightest one.

Tones of #594563
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#555256 is the less saturated color, while #6f04a4 is the most saturated one.
